The House of Representatives will vote on the National Origin-Based Antidiscrimination for Nonimmigrants Act (NO BAN Act) TOMORROW, Thursday, March 12th. The NO BAN Act would end the harmful refugee, Muslim, and asylum bans put in place by this administration, including the most recent expansion of the Muslim/African ban issued on January 31, 2020, and establish vital protections against future discriminatory bans.
